Massachusetts weather is tough on roofs. Heavy snow loads in winter can strain your structure. Frequent rain and wind can lead to leaks and damage. Summers can bring heat, and fall storms are common. This means your roof needs to be strong and well-maintained. Many homes here have traditional styles, but the elements are the main concern. When should I replace my Massachusetts roof?

Look for signs like ice dams in winter or leaks after storms, common in Massachusetts. The constant freeze-thaw cycles also wear down materials. Addressing these issues promptly is key. We offer free inspections and quotes for your peace of mind.
